Watercress Soup with Ribs is a comforting and flavorful dish originating from Chinese cuisine, often enjoyed for its nourishing qualities. This soup features tender pork ribs simmered until succulent, paired with vibrant, peppery watercress. Common additions include goji berries, red dates, carrots, and sometimes ginger for an added depth of flavor. Watercress, the star ingredient, is packed with vitamins A, C, and K, along with antioxidants that promote immune health and detoxification. The slow-cooked pork ribs infuse the broth with a rich, savory taste and add protein for muscle repair and energy. While the dish is wholesome, the natural sodium of certain ingredients and the fat content of ribs may require mindful consumption for those watching their salt or fat intake. A balanced, traditional choice for warmth and nutrition.
